牛顿插值的现代应用
幸盾宋780牛顿插值公式(已知三点求函数解析式) 可以详细的说明下么.. -
伏勤玲17772415308 ______[答案] 牛顿插值法 插值法利用函数f (x)在某区间中若干点的函数值,作出适当的特定函数,在这些点上取已知值,在区间的其他点上用这特定函数的值作为函数f (x)的近似值.如果这特定函数是多项式,就称它为插值多项式.利用插值...
幸盾宋780c++ 牛顿插值法 -
伏勤玲17772415308 ______ 好2处数组下标溢出 1、g数组只有N个元素,下标可访问区间为[0 , N-1],下面这个代码相当于访问了g[N]了 for(j=N;j>i;j--) { g[j]=(g[j]-g[j-1])/(x[j]-x[j-i-1]); } 2、g数组最大不能到达N,当i=N的时候,tmp*g[i]这里会访问溢出 for(i=1;i<=N;i++) { tmp*=(u-x[i-1]); newton=newton+tmp*g[i]; }
幸盾宋780用C语言实现拉格朗日插值、牛顿插值、等距结点插值算法 -
伏勤玲17772415308 ______ #include#include #include typedef struct data { float x; float y; }Data;//变量x和函数值y的结构 Data d[20];//最多二十组数据 float f(int s,int t)//牛顿插值法,用以返回插商 { if(t==s+1) return (d[t].y-d[s].y)/(d[t].x-d[s].x); else return (f(s+1,t)-f(s,t-1))/(d[t].x-d[...
幸盾宋780泰勒公式的应用 -
伏勤玲17772415308 ______ 1.泰勒公式的应用例举 下载地址 http://www.cnki.com.cn/Article/CJFDTotal-KJXI200814051.htm2.f(x)=f(x0)+f'(x0)*(x-x0)+f''(x0)/2!*(x-x0)^2+...+f(n)(x0)/n!*(x-x0)^n (泰勒...
幸盾宋780函数f(x)=limx^n/(1+x^n){n→∞},讨论函数f(x)的连续性 -
伏勤玲17772415308 ______ x>1时,f(x)=lim1/(1/x^n+1){n→∞}=1 x=时,f(x)=1/2 -1<x<1时,f(x)=0 x=-1时,f(x)不存在 x<-1时,f(x)=lim1/(1/x^n+1){n→∞}=1 故间断点为-1,0
幸盾宋780有人会用MATLAB计算拉格朗日插值 和 牛顿插值么!!! -
伏勤玲17772415308 ______ function f=Language(x,y,x0)%求已知数据点的拉格朗日插值多项式%已知数据点的x坐标向量:x%已知数据点的y坐标向量:y%插值的x坐标:x0%求得的拉格朗日插值多项式在x0处的插值:f syms t; if(length(x)==length(y)) n=length(x); else disp('x...
幸盾宋780MATLAB中牛顿插值应使用什么函数加以调用? -
伏勤玲17772415308 ______ function fp = newton_interpolation(x,y,p)% Script for Newton's Interpolation.% Muhammad Rafiullah Arain% Mathematics & Basic Sciences Department% NED University of Engineering & Technology - Karachi% Pakistan.% ---------% x and y are ...
幸盾宋780牛顿算法和拉格朗日插值算法的C语言实现 -
伏勤玲17772415308 ______ 已经编译运行确认: #include #include #include typedef struct data { float x; float y; }Data;//变量x和函数值y的结构 Data d[20];//最多二十组数据 float f(int s,int t)//牛顿插值法,用以返回插商 { if(t==s+1) return (d[t].y-d[s].y)/(d[t].x-d[s].x); else return ...
幸盾宋780牛顿是一个傻子吗? -
伏勤玲17772415308 ______ 牛顿是傻子,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,那我们都是猪!
幸盾宋780牛顿插值计算的c++代码 -
伏勤玲17772415308 ______ double newton(double *x, double *y, int n, double num, int cur, int pointNum, double answer) { //计算均差 for(int i = pointNum -1; i>cur; i--) { y[i] = ( y[i] - y[i-1] ) / ( x[i] - x[i-1] ); } //已经计算完cur自加 cur++; //temp进行临时计算 double temp = y[...